Global Reusable Water Bottles Market to Reach US$11.2 Billion by 2030

The global market for Reusable Water Bottles estimated at US$8.6 Billion in the year 2024, is expected to reach US$11.2 Billion by 2030, growing at a CAGR of 4.5% over the analysis period 2024-2030. Plastic, one of the segments analyzed in the report, is expected to record a 4.5% CAGR and reach US$5.0 Billion by the end of the analysis period. Growth in the Stainless Steel segment is estimated at 5.3% CAGR over the analysis period.

The U.S. Market is Estimated at US$1.7 Billion While China is Forecast to Grow at 6.1% CAGR

The Reusable Water Bottles market in the U.S. is estimated at US$1.7 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$2.2 Billion by the year 2030 trailing a CAGR of 6.1%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 2.5% and 4.2%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 3.7% CAGR.

Global Reusable Water Bottles Market - Key Trends & Drivers Summarized

How Are Reusable Water Bottles Promoting Sustainability and Health?

Reusable water bottles are playing a crucial role in promoting sustainability and personal health by reducing the reliance on single-use plastic bottles and encouraging regular hydration. Made from materials such as stainless steel, glass, and BPA-free plastics, reusable bottles offer a durable, eco-friendly alternative to disposable bottles. They are available in various sizes, designs, and functionalities, catering to diverse consumer needs and preferences. The increasing awareness of environmental pollution caused by plastic waste and the health benefits of staying hydrated are driving the popularity of reusable water bottles. Their role in reducing plastic waste and promoting healthy habits makes them a vital part of the sustainability movement.

What Are the Benefits and Challenges of Using Reusable Water Bottles?

The benefits of using reusable water bottles include environmental protection, cost savings, and health safety. By reducing the consumption of single-use plastics, reusable bottles help decrease plastic waste and lower the environmental impact. They also offer cost savings over time, as consumers do not need to purchase disposable bottles frequently. Health-wise, reusable bottles made from safe materials do not leach harmful chemicals, ensuring safer drinking water. However, challenges include the need for regular cleaning to prevent bacterial growth and the higher initial cost compared to disposable bottles. Addressing these challenges involves educating consumers about proper maintenance and the long-term benefits of investing in reusable water bottles.

How Are Technological Advancements Enhancing Reusable Water Bottles?

Technological advancements are significantly enhancing the functionality and appeal of reusable water bottles. Innovations in material science are leading to the development of lightweight, durable, and safe materials that improve the user experience. Advanced manufacturing techniques are enabling the production of bottles with better insulation properties, keeping beverages hot or cold for extended periods. Smart bottle technologies, such as built-in hydration tracking and UV sterilization, are providing added convenience and promoting healthier hydration habits. These technological improvements are making reusable water bottles more attractive and practical for consumers, driving their adoption across various lifestyles and activities.

What Factors Are Driving the Growth in the Reusable Water Bottles Market?

The growth in the reusable water bottles market is driven by several factors. The increasing environmental awareness and the global push to reduce plastic waste are major drivers, encouraging consumers to switch to reusable options. Technological advancements in materials and design are enhancing the functionality and appeal of reusable bottles. The rise of health and wellness trends is also boosting demand, as more people recognize the importance of staying hydrated and avoiding harmful chemicals in disposable bottles. Additionally, government regulations and corporate initiatives promoting sustainability are supporting market growth. These factors collectively ensure the sustained expansion and innovation in the reusable water bottles market.
